Child marriage ban, year-round Daylight Saving time signed into law – Florida Politics

(Florida Politics) – A bill that would ban marriages for anyone under the age of 17 and legislation expressing the state’s intent to observe Daylight Saving time year-round were among 74 bills Gov. Rick Scott signed into law on Friday.

The marriage bill (SB 140) prevents minors from being granted nuptial licenses. With parental consent, 17-year-olds can wed under the new law to a partner within two years of age.
